테스트 사이트 - 개발 중인 베타 버전입니다

숫자에 대응되는 단위를 구할려면 어떻게..?? 채택완료

포도야놀쟈 10년 전 조회 2,390

안녕하세여 질문하나 드릴께여..?? num  val(대응되는값) 1  - 10 2  - 100 3  - 1000 4  - 10000 또는 num 1  - 0.1 2  - 0.01 3  - 0.001 4  - 0.0001 num은 유동적입니다.. 그러니까 1이면 10을 나타낼려구여 어떤 방법이 있나여.. 특정함수를 사용하지 않고 로직으로만 해결 할 수 있는지.. for문을 반복하여 스트링을 변환시키는것 말구는 방법이 없는지.. 이거 수학이 넘 약해서리....!!!  

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트
10년 전
올리신 예는 제곱근을 구하는 식 이네요...

제곱근을 구하는 함수는 pow()입니다.



echo pow( 10, 3 ); => 결과 : 1000

echo pow( 10, -3 ); => 결과 : 0.001



이 이외의 것 이라면.. 간단한게 함수로 구현하면 됩니다..



간단한 것이라면 중고등학교때 배우는 연산자 정의를 이용하시면 됩니다.



좀더 수학적으로 한다면 수열을 사용하셔서 일반열의 식을 추출하시면

됩니다..
로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인